What are Remote Control Mobility Scooters?
Remote control mobility scooters are individual mobility gadgets that can be operated via a remote control, enabling users to navigate their surroundings without physically engaging with the scooter. This innovation is particularly useful for individuals with limited mobility or those who may have problem operating standard scooters due to physical limitations.

Are push-button control mobility scooters safe?
Yes, push-button control mobility scooters are geared up with a number of safety functions, including brakes, anti-tip designs, and reflectors. It's important to check out the manual and follow safety standards for optimal use.
2. How far can a push-button control mobility scooter travel on a single charge?
The variety usually differs in between 15-25 miles, depending on the scooter's battery capacity, surface, and user weight.
3. Can I drive a push-button control mobility scooter on the roadway?
Laws on roadway use differ by region. In lots of areas, scooters are permitted on sidewalks but not on highways. Constantly check your local laws for guidance.
4. Do remote control mobility scooters include guarantees?
Most brand names use service warranties ranging from one to 3 years on parts and battery. It's important to inspect particular terms and conditions before purchase.
5. What happens if the battery passes away while I'm utilizing the scooter?
If your scooter's battery runs out, you will need to manually run it to get to a charging station or power outlet. Some scooters have manual override choices for emergencies.
